Prevalence of the Feavearyear Surname

The Feavearyear surname has a relatively low incidence globally, with the majority of individuals bearing this surname located in England. According to data, England has the highest incidence of the Feavearyear surname, with 37 individuals having this surname.

United States

In the United States, the Feavearyear surname is less common, with a total of 26 individuals carrying this name. The surname likely arrived in the US through immigration from England, with individuals seeking new opportunities and a fresh start in the new world.

Australia and New Zealand

Both Australia and New Zealand have a minimal incidence of the Feavearyear surname, with only one individual in each country bearing this name. It is possible that these individuals are descendants of English immigrants who brought the surname with them to the southern hemisphere.

Thailand

Interestingly, Thailand also has a small number of individuals with the Feavearyear surname, with just one person bearing this name. The presence of the surname in Thailand could be attributed to expatriates or individuals with English heritage residing in the country.
